The majority race in 18509 overall is white, making up 80.1% of residents. The next most-common racial group is hispanic at 10.3%. There are more white people in the east areas of the zip. People who identify as hispanic are most likely to be living in the southwest places. Diversity and Diversity Scores for 18509, PA
The map below shows diversity in 18509. Areas in green are more diverse, while areas in red are much less diverse. Diversity, in this case, means a mixture of people with different race and ethnicity living close to one another. For example, all-black and all-white areas in the zip would both be considered lacking diversity.
Diversity Score
18509 Diversity Score
70
With a diversity score of 70 out of 100, 18509 is more diverse than other US zip codes. The most diverse area within 18509's proper boundaries is to the southwest of the zip. The least diverse areas are located in the east parts of 18509.
